This City of London facility opened in 1963 and was renovated in 1990. It features:
- Two ice surfaces
- Spectator seating and heated viewing area
- Vending machines
- Skate sharpening during winter season
- Change rooms
Carling Arena is available for summer and winter programming. Summer months include dry pad usage, and there’s indoor public skating during the winter.
This is one of ten City of London facilities with indoor ice. The other facilities include: Argyle Arena, Bostwick Arena, Earl Nichols Arena, Farquharson Arena, Kinsmen Arena, Lambeth Arena, Medway Arena, Oakridge Arena and Stronach Arena.
